Vilhelm Lauritzen (b. Slagelse 1894, d. Gentofte 1984)

Unique cabinet of solid ash wood, low frame with round legs. Front with tambour doors in two levels, interior with shelf at top and multiple pull-out trays below. Handles and fittings of brass. Designed and made 1941 by cabinetmaker Thorald Madsen, with remnants of maker's paper label. H. 129 cm. D. 48.5 cm. W. 100 cm.

Provenance: Designed and made for Vilhelm Lauritzen's brother and his wife as a present for their 25th wedding anniversary. Hence by descent in the family.
